Abstract
The work aims to optimize the industrial shape of a special ground vehicle, and improve its survivability in radar detection environments so as to enhance the stealth capabilities of special ground vehicles, and expand the modeling design features of the vehicles. Firstly, the modeling design features of the body were summarized based on radar stealth design principles with the body modeling outline as the design element. Then, shape grammar and parametric design tools were used to conduct multiple body modeling designs with the body modeling outline constructed. Finally, the RCS values of different modeling schemes were calculated through numerical simulation and the most optimal scheme was selected to conduct detailed modeling design. Overall, all optimized design schemes exhibited a comprehensive decrease in RCS values compared with the original body. The optimal scheme achieved a 55% reduction in RCS values, with maximum reductions of 58% for front view angles and 43% for side view angles. These results successfully met the expected design goals and effectively enhanced both overall modeling and stealth performance of the body. In conclusion, taking wheeled special vehicles as an example, radar stealth design principles were utilized to construct multiple body modeling schemes with shape grammar and parametric design tools. Through RCS simulations, the study provides rational verification and evaluation for optimizing stealth modeling designs of special vehicles while improving efficiency in multi-scheme body modeling designs. It also offers valuable insights for industrial designers working on stealth models for special vehicles.
